English: Little Haw, also known as South Haw, is a 499m summit in North Yorkshire, England, on the boundary of Colsterdale and Nidderdale. The summit is about 1 mile east of the summit of Great Haw. The civil parishes of Healey and Stonebeck Up meet at the summit.
The hill should not be confused with another hill also called Little Haw, about half a mile north of Great Haw. The two Little Haws are only about 1.5 miles apart.
